Abstract

A device may intercept a triggering operation for target positioning in the virtual interactive scene; obtain a location of a triggering point on a screen. The device may determine a plurality of adsorption point locations based on the location of the triggering point and a plurality of adsorption points on a virtual target, the adsorption point locations respectively associated with the adsorption points. The device may generate, in response to the location of the triggering point being within an adsorption range of at least one of the adsorption point locations, a plurality of adsorption point weight values corresponding to the adsorption points. The device may adjust the triggering point to an adsorption point location at which an adsorption point corresponding to a largest adsorption point weight value is located. Flexibility of target positioning in the virtual interactive scene may be effectively enhanced.
